Package com.google.apphosting.runtime
Class RequestManager.Builder
java.lang.Object
com.google.apphosting.runtime.RequestManager.Builder
- Enclosing class:
- RequestManager
Builder for of a RequestManager instance.
-
Method Summary
Modifier and TypeMethodDescriptionabstract RequestManagerbuild()abstract longabstract booleanabstract longabstract booleanabstract intabstract RequestManager.Builderabstract RequestManager.BuildersetCyclesPerSecond(long x) abstract RequestManager.BuildersetDisableDeadlineTimers(boolean x) abstract RequestManager.Builderabstract RequestManager.BuildersetHardDeadlineDelay(long x) abstract RequestManager.BuildersetInterruptFirstOnSoftDeadline(boolean x) abstract RequestManager.BuildersetMaxOutstandingApiRpcs(int x) abstract RequestManager.Builderabstract RequestManager.BuildersetSoftDeadlineDelay(long x) abstract RequestManager.BuildersetThreadStopTerminatesClone(boolean x) abstract RequestManager.BuildersetWaitForDaemonRequestThreads(boolean x) abstract longabstract booleanabstract boolean
-
Method Details
-
setSoftDeadlineDelay
-
softDeadlineDelay
public abstract long softDeadlineDelay() -
setHardDeadlineDelay
-
hardDeadlineDelay
public abstract long hardDeadlineDelay() -
setDisableDeadlineTimers
-
disableDeadlineTimers
public abstract boolean disableDeadlineTimers() -
setRuntimeLogSink
-
setApiProxyImpl
-
setMaxOutstandingApiRpcs
-
maxOutstandingApiRpcs
public abstract int maxOutstandingApiRpcs() -
setThreadStopTerminatesClone
-
threadStopTerminatesClone
public abstract boolean threadStopTerminatesClone() -
setInterruptFirstOnSoftDeadline
-
interruptFirstOnSoftDeadline
public abstract boolean interruptFirstOnSoftDeadline() -
setCyclesPerSecond
-
cyclesPerSecond
public abstract long cyclesPerSecond() -
setWaitForDaemonRequestThreads
-
waitForDaemonRequestThreads
public abstract boolean waitForDaemonRequestThreads() -
setEnvironment
-
build
-